A triangle has vertices at B(−3, 0), C(2, −1), D(−1, 2). Which transformation would produce an image with vertices B″(−2, 1), C″

(3, 2), D″(0, −1)?

Mathematics
1 answer:
vichka [17]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Flip vertical then shift (translation) right 1 unit

Step-by-step explanation:

A (-3,0)   B (2,-1)  C (-1,2) .... green triangle

Flip vertical becomes

A (-3,1)   B (2,2)  C (-1,-1) .... blue triangle

shift to right 1 unit

A (-2,1)   B (3,2)  C (0,-1) .... red triangle
